With the Europe 2020 strategy, the EU has committeditself to promote smart, sustainable and inclusivegrowth. The EU developed the concept of the SmartSpecialisation Strategy (RIS31) for the implementati-on at the national and regional level, which is to serveas the relevant long-term frame of reference. The aimof the strategies developed inclusively with stakehol-ders and relevant partners is to achieve a more effi-cient use of funds and synergy effects in the relevantpolicy fields at the different levels.

As a knowledge-based development concept, SmartSpecialisation is a locational element of the EU 2020strategy for smart, sustainable and inclusive growth.At the EU level, the concept of Smart Specialisation isan integral part of EU cohesion policy as one of theso-called ex-ante conditionalities. The allocation offunds from the European Fund for Regional Develop-

ment for research, technology development and innovation is thus contingent on the national or regional Smart Specialisation strategies. The in -tention here is to guarantee a more efficient, strategy-guided deployment of EU cohesion funds for R&Dand innovation.3

The explanations on the policy framework for SmartSpecialisation in Austria presented in the followingsections were prepared with a view to the ex-anteconditionalities of EU cohesion policy 2014 to 2020.Within the scope of the monitoring process for theimplementation of the partnership agreement, theSTRAT.AT 2020 Partnership “Smart Specialisation”was established within the framework of the Austrian Conference on Spatial Planning (Österrei-chische Raumordnungskonferenz, ÖROK) (seewww.oerok.gv.at). This partnership provides a plat-form for sharing views on the concept of Smart Specialisation well as on the relevant strategies of thefederal government and of the Länder.

Box 1: The concept of Smart Specialisation – core elements2

g They direct financial assistance and investmentmeasures to the key national and regional prio-rities, challenges and needs to achieve know -ledge-based development.

g They are based on the specific strengths, com-petitive advantages and capacity knowledge ofthe Länder and regions.

g They support technology and practice-basedinnovation, and serve as incentive for invest-ments by the private sector.

g They fully involve stakeholders in all aspectsand encourage innovation and experimentati-on.

g They are evidence-based and include well-thought-out monitoring and evaluation systems.

The research, technology and innovation (RTI) stra-tegy of the federal government “Becoming an Inno-vation Leader” was therefore sent to the EuropeanCommission as the core document for Smart Special -isation in Austria and as fulfilment of the ex-ante con-ditionalities of the ESI Funds Common Provisions Re-gulation 2014–2020, and was accepted as such by theEuropean Commission.4

In Austria, apart from the federal level, the Länder –also referred to as regions in this context – may act au-tonomously in non-sovereign fields. They have politi-cal representatives and corresponding budgets. In thepast decades, the Länder have gained a more promi-nent role in the area of RTI, encouraged, among otherthings, by (i) the instruments of EU regional policy,(ii) the concept of Regional Innovation Systems and(iii) impulses from the federal government, especiallywithin the framework of the “structural programmes”.Therefore, for Austria a “Policy Framework for SmartSpecialisation” is in place in which the research,technology and innovation strategy of the federal go-vernment is the core element and serves as centralframe of reference for the regional level and their RTIstrategies. This policy framework is presented in thefollowing sections in an overview of the Research,Technology and Innovation Strategy of the federal go-vernment and the RTI strategies of the Länder.

It must also be mentioned in this context that Austriahas played an active role from the very start in defi-ning the content and influencing discussions regar-ding Smart Specialisation. Austria – jointly with Flan-ders and Finland – was the initiator and leader of theinternational OECD project ”Smart Specialisation inGlobal Value Chains” through which the OECD sup-ported the European Commission with proposals forregional implementation and with practical exam-ples. Austria is one of the key partners for the Europe-an Commission and the Joint Research Center in Se-villa (S3 Platform) for putting the academic conceptof Smart Specialisation into practice. To this end,“RIS3-KEY” was developed, which among other

things, provides European regions with uncompli -cated start up help for the RIS3 concept.5 The FederalMinistry for Science, Research and the Economy aswell as regions such as Upper Austria and Lower Au-stria cooperate with DG REGIO of the European Com-mission and with partner regions throughout Europeto achieve a comprehensive implementation of theconcept. The Federal Ministry for Science, Researchand the Economy has a staff unit for knowledge-driven business location policy and Smart Specialisa-tion.6

We would like to stress that the discussion regardingSmart Specialisation has heavily and positively influ-enced the current generation of research, technologyand innovation strategies. In particular, the more in-tense involvement of universities in territorial deve-lopment strategies has brought new qualities to theprocess of location development.

Austria’s position on Smart Specialisation and its im-plementation described below was prepared and dis-cussed within the scope of the Smart Specialisationpartnership.

Box 2: Austria’s Approach to Smart Specialisation

The concept of Smart Specialisation is a European frame of reference for (regional) research, technologyand innovation policies. For Austria, Smart Specialisation is a concept of long-term relevance that aims toboost growth and competitiveness.

With the concept of Smart Specialisation, a new generation of business location strategies has been deve -loped that defines thematic investment priorities for those locations where the specific strengths, compe-tencies and development potentials hold the promise of boosting the economy and society. They are basedon innovation and international market success thereby also enabling it to master future challenges. For Austria, the long-term potential of the concept is perceived to lie in the support provided for a new knowled-ge-driven location policy. The strategies are designed to facilitate the development of a productive “eco-sy-stem” that originates in the region.

From Austria’s perspective, a particularly valuable element is the process of “entrepreneurial discovery”.This refers to the ongoing process of participation by enterprises and the knowledge sector, and to the closerinvolvement of business, administration, education and research as well as NGOs within the innovation sy-stem to jointly develop themes.

Newer empirical analyses by WIFO point out the special significance of diversification of regional economicstructures into new areas based on their existing economic and technological competencies, while hardlyany growth impulses may be expected from a narrow industry specialisation. In this respect, the concept of“Smart Diversification” is more meaningful and useful when referring to the (re-)combination of strengthswith technologies of the future, new markets and target groups to achieve a transformation process.

Austria would like to stress the following points that not only contribute to the further contextual develop-ment of the concept, but also increases its relevance for practice. g Open with respect to process design: Smart specialisation should be understood as a process in which

the relevant stakeholders work together in location development by taking an evidence-based and out -come-oriented approach. Flexibility in the interpretation and concrete application of the core elementsof RIS3 must be possible in the Member States and their regions. When assessing Smart Specialisationstrategies, existing practices for “strategy formulation” in the Member States and regions, the political rea-lities and framework conditions must be taken into account. This would support acceptance of the con-cept among the policy actors.

g Open with respect to content: From Austria’s perspective, the issue on hand is not so much to proceed ac-cording to a master plan, but rather to organise an ongoing development process. This may be achieved,for example, by “rolling planning” or by multi-tier planning (e.g. concrete implementation of general stra-tegies in working programmes).

g Open with respect to innovation: An open interpretation of the concept of innovation is advocated toachieve a wider integration of approaches such as open innovation and social innovation as well as crea-tivity and to include social themes in the strategy. Austria has a broad understanding of the concept of in-novation which is not restricted exclusively to technology and is well aware of the fact that it needs toachieve progress in the area of “social innovation”.

g Consideration of framework conditions: Coordination of the policy areas is an important factor. It ispointed out in this context that EU financial assistance legislation must grant adequate room for the ap-plication of instruments to promote business and innovation in order to be able to advance Smart Specia-lisation accordingly.

Box 3: Empirical Evidence for Austria in the Context of Smart Specialisation“Smart diversification based on endogenous strengths”

The latest research by WIFO7 for Austria shows that based on an overall economic assessment, the growthimpulses for employment and the labour market tend to come less from a narrow specialisation on a few in-dustries and leading sectors, but rather from a regional diversity of industries. A differentiated analysis bysector and region reveals that in human capital-intensive urban regions and their surrounding areas and al-so in manufacturing so-called “related diversity” has a significant positive correlation with employment dy-namic. In the more rural regions – usually without any prominent industrial cores – the growth impulses foremployment and the labour market tend to come from unrelated diversity of industries.

“Related diversity” means a portfolio of similar and related industries. Therefore, it is not individual sectorsthat are crucial for growth and employment, but rather a diverse array of related industries. These empiricalfindings thus support arguments in favour of a regional structural policy that places a greater focus on di-versification of economic structures, combined with well-thought-out vertical priorities.

Therefore, the further development of a regional economic structure should not concentrate primarily on anarrow core of clusters or strong points, but rather along auxiliary, related industries and on promising tech-nologies that are still weakly developed.

This essentially corresponds to the concept of Smart Specialisation, which, according to its fundamentalconception, it is not the deepening of regional areas of competence, but rather a “recombination” (e.g. wide-ning of existing know-how by adding new technologies/knowledge areas such as mechatronics, industry 4.0or transformation processes such as the transition from the manufacture of textiles for garments to industri-al high-tech textiles).

Therefore, the aim is to support entrepreneurial search and discovery processes to promote a forward-looking diversification based on existing competencies and endogenous strengths. In this respect, the empi-rical results are evidence of the feasibility of the concept of Smart Specialisation for Austria. However, it alsoshows that a narrow and static interpretation of the concept should be avoided.

Dynamic change within the innovation system

Austria’s innovation system and innovation policyunderwent a process of far-reaching change that be-gan at the latest with the phase of integration into theEU in the 1990s. The trend of a wider understandingof systemic innovation changes was accompanied bya change in the perceived role of research, technologyand innovation policy. The allocation of public fundsfor R&D increased substantially and likewise privateinvestment in research and development by the busi-ness sector. The thematically-focused programmeswere expanded and supplemented by structural pro-grammes to reduce recognized RTI weaknesses.8 La-ter on, a reorganisation of the institutional landscapealso took place (reform of agencies, creation of theCouncil for Research and Technology as an advisorybody to the federal government, University Organisa-tion Act, improved evaluation culture9). The transiti-on towards a research-intensive innovation system isthe most pronounced feature of this transformation.In this manner, Austria rose to ranks of the so-called“innovation followers" on the EU scoreboard by themid-2000s.

Basis for the shift in paradigm: evidence-based policy

The practice of regularly conducting analyses10 andevaluations, especially the evaluation of the Austria’sfinancial assistance schemes for research11 helped tomake it clear that a transformation of the growth pa-radigm was needed in Austria. Specifically, a shiftfrom the long-standing successful strategy of imitati-ve technology focused on the intelligent adaptionand rapid diffusion of technological developmentstowards a growth course driven by research and inno-vation in the role of technology frontrunner (from“catching-up” to “frontrunning”). This phase wassupported by a broad discourse and consultationprocess carried out throughout the country within

the scope of the Austrian Research Dialogue (Öster-reichischer Forschungsdialog) and by the proposalsand recommendations made by the Council for Re-search and Technology Development in the summer2009 for the further development of Austria’s researchand innovation system.

Interactive policy process for strategy development

Based on the preparatory work and regular feedbackrounds with the relevant stakeholders as well as theexchange of views with international experts, the Re-search, Technology and Innovation Strategy (RTI)“Becoming an Innovation Leader” was prepared wit-hin the scope of a broad inter-ministerial discussionprocess.

Austria’s strategy processes are characterized by along-standing culture of systematic inclusion of sta-keholder interests and ideas. In the spirit of an “entre-

preneurial discovery process”, strategic prioritiescontain both bottom-up and top-down elements (seee.g. Austrian Research Dialogue12). The participatingparties could rely on a broad range of analyticalworks, on the one hand, and on normative (strategic)recommendations, on the other. The economic andsocial partners and representatives of the Länder we-re involved in the critical areas. Therefore, the Austri-an RTI strategy is an expression of a consistent, evi-dence-based and interactive policy process. Thepreparation process resulted in a common resolution of the government. The jointly defined objective forAustri: Becoming an Innovation Leader (see Box 5, page 17).

Overall, the RTI strategy follows a systemic approachin which the attainment of the objective is supportedby various interactively coordinated measures(school education; promotion of talents; increase ac-ceptance of RTI themes in society; integration andgender issues; financing and financial assistancestructures, etc.). The term innovation is used as an

open concept and also covers social and organisatio-nal processes. This broad view matches the require-ments of a mature, internationally-networked natio-nal system of innovation.

Creating incentives for private R&D investment

The principal aim is to significantly increase the R&Dratio to 3.76% by 2020.13 In this context, Austria reliesheavily on the R&D activities of businesses and the le-verage effect of investments by the public sector as animportant prerequisite for Austria’s competitivenessand international appeal as a business location. Thestrategy dedicates a separate section to the goal ofachieving at least two-thirds private-sector RTI financing.

The specific design of the instruments and program-mes is done at the operational level by the competentministries or agencies (see page 20 “The Strategy as aProcess”).

Policy mix and thematic focus of financial assistance for research

In line with the transformation of innovation policy,the instruments used are strongly oriented on struc-tural problems such as to improve cooperation bet-ween science and business, the creation of criticalmass, accelerate the dynamic of start-ups andgrowth, and increase the number of businesses enga-ged in R&D and innovation. In this context, the diver-sified economic structures and the strong focus ofcompanies on niches are taken into account. Re-search shows that it is especially the “frontrunnercompanies” in Austria who pursue “niche strategies”with the ambition of becoming technology and mar-ket leaders in their respective segments. These fron-trunner companies reflect the diversity of the econo-mic and research structures.17

Predominant in this context are the thematically-open programmes. The COMET Programme (Com-petence Centers for Excellent Technologies)18 plays akey role. Its diverse programming lines are focused onestablishing strategically-networked research struc-tures at the interface between science and the econo-my. By applying a technologically-open bottom-upapproach to the financial assistance programmes, thecentres mirror the special (regional) strengths. CO-MET Centers are therefore the anchor points for re-gional specialisation strategies. The COMET Pro-gramme has its own programming line which helps toidentify new and promising thematic areas throughthe so-called “K projects”19 .

The thematically-open programmes for businesseshave the aim of boosting R&D activities of compa-nies in general, increasing the number of compa-nies engaged in R&D and innovation as well as supporting the development of technology leadersacross all industries. This technologically-open approach to financial assistance takes into accountthe fact that scientific innovation, trends and specialisations emerge from existing research environments or are adopted and implemented insuch settings.20

Thematic priorities

The RTI strategy of the federal government estab -lishes the thematic priorities for the period until 2020that form an important framework for the definitionof areas of strength oriented on social and economicchallenges or for which strategies for industry clusters are developed and implemented on the basisof the RTI strategy. Notwithstanding the promotion ofexcellence at research institutions, investments in in-frastructure and initiatives to support innovation (e.g.innovation for services and tourism – see below), thefollowing thematic priorities – in the meaning ofSmart Specialisation – have been defined for the pe-riod until 2020:21

Services innovation and tourism

The promotion of innovative services, the creative industries and tourism plays a special role. Innovativeservices and the creative industries are supported byseparate programmes and organisations (e.g. Kreativ-wirtschaft Austria http://www.kreativwirtschaft.at/and Austria Wirtschaftsservice – Bereich Kreativwirt-schaft: http://www.awsg.at ). Moreover, a specific positioning is being developed for tourism within the scope of a management process(http://www.bmwfw.gv.at/Tourismus/Seiten/Touris-musstrategie.aspx). In this case, the paradigms of higher quality and (service) innovation have replacedthose of capacity expansion.24

Budgetary scope

Federal level

The federal government’s decision to adopt the RTIstrategy is a declaration to provide financing for RTImeasures in accordance with the strategy for a multi-year period. Within this scope, the competent mini-stries for research, technology development and in-novation have a budget and commission agencieswith the execution of financial assistance program-mes.

Spending on R&D by the federal government and theLänder will amount to around EUR 3.7 billion in 2016(ca. 35% of total R&D spending) according to estima-tes by Statistik Austria. The share of the federal go-vernment accounts for around 87%.25

As a consequence of the increase in public and priva-te R&D funding, the R&D ratio, which had been only1.45% in 1993, rose to over 3% by 2014. This level hasbeen maintained ever since despite some minor fluc-tuations. From 2014 to 2016, government spendingon R&D increased by 4.8% according to current esti-mates. Corporate spending on R&D increased in thesame period by 7.7%. At a GDP growth rate of around6.1% in the same period, this results in a stable R&Dratio which is forecast to rise to 3.07% in 2016.26

The table below shows the medium-term financialframework for the funding of research and develop-ment in Austria until 2020.

The federal agencies received the funds set out belowfrom the federal budget in 2016 which are also inclu-ded in the figures given in Table 1 (spending for R&Dfunding by the federal government 2016 to 2020): 27

g Fund for the promotion of scientific research(Fonds zur Förderung der wissenschaftlichen For-schung): EUR 184.2 million.

The strategy as a process: operationalisation, monitoring and evaluation

The operationalisation and concrete design of the instruments and programmes of the RTI strategy isthe responsibility of the competent ministries andagencies.g The coordination and the related overall mon -

itoring of implementation of the strategy are managed by the Department for Research Coordi-nation of the Federal Chancellery.

g An inter-ministerial “RTI Task Force” was established for the management and operationali-sation of strategy implementation at the highestofficial level supported by thematically-specificWorking Groups (e.g. on themes such as researchinfrastructure, internationalisation and RTI exter-

nal policy or climate change/scarce resources)31. Within the work of the Task Force for the imple-mentation of the RTI strategy and in its workinggroups, targeted priorities are defined based onthe central problem areas to be able to identify thestrengths and weaknesses of the structural trans-formation and thus derive concrete recommenda-tions for actions and their implementation.

g The Council for Research, Technology Develop-ment and Innovation (Rat für Forschung, Techno-logieentwicklung und Innovation) was commis-sioned in 2010 by the government to monitorstrategy implementation. To this end, the Councilfor Research, Technology Development and Inno-vation prepares an annual report on Austria’s capa-city potential in science and technology32. The pro-gress of strategy implementation is monitoredusing an extensive set of indicators assigned toeach of the objectives.

g The federal government prepares a Research andTechnology Report every year. The two reportsmentioned are brought to the attention of Parlia-ment.

g The principle of effective budget managementimplies a stronger focus of the guidelines on thecontent of the objectives and the indicators.Thus, a written evaluation concept is preparedfor each financial assistance programme andmeasure that is based on the RTI Guidelines. Forthe purpose of recording the required informati-on, adequate monitoring must be set up that de-livers standardised basic data for the life of theproject.

g Evaluation culture is therefore highly developed inAustria. A separate platform for research and tech-nology evaluation has been established – fteval(http://www.fteval.at) and the persons responsiblefor RTI policy and the evaluators are representedon this platform. In the past, evaluations have of-ten served as the starting point for critical RTI policy changes.

Coordination federal government/Länder

The strategic coordination for each of the specificthemes takes place using information and exchangeforums:

g Mutual bilateral participation in strategy develop-ment, especially by federal organisations in the re-gional RTI strategy processes in order to take ac-count of the overarching strategies.

g The “Bundesländerdialog” – the policy platformfor national and regional governments and agen-cies in science, research and innovation” set up bythe Federal Ministry of Science, Research and Eco-nomy is the established platform of the federal go-vernment and Länder for the exchange of informa-tion in the areas of science and research, andenlarged by the inclusion of a group of stakeholderorganisations. The platform “Bundesländerdialog”creates the basis for the ministries and the Länderto coordinate their policies more closely and defi-ne the themes.36

g The “Platform RTI Austria” (Plattform FTI-Öster-reich) set up by the Council for Research and Tech-nology Development meets twice a year and servesas an information hub for the Länder and theagencies for the financial assistance schemes forall areas of the innovation system. Its meetings al-ternate and are coordinated with the meetings ofthe “Bundesländerdialog”.

g The federal government and the Länder coordina-te their structural policies within the scope of theAustrian Conference for Spatial Planning (Öster-reichische Raumordnungskonferenz). 37

g At the instruments level, important RTI policy in-struments are funded jointly by the federal govern-ment and Länder (e.g. COMET Programme) or areco-financed by the Länder (e.g. financial assistan-ce for enterprise R&D projects). The exchange ofinformation and coordination is also supportedwithin the Cluster Platform.38

Box 7: Mid-term Report on the RTI strategy of the federal government33

After five years of implementation of the RTI strategy of the federal government, a mid-term report was pre-pared to reflect on the implementation process and the framework conditions of RTI strategy implementa-tion to date. According to the report, the RTI strategy has become established as an important long-term andcommon framework for policymakers and administration bodies. The RTI strategy’s broad and systemic per-spective has also helped to improve the coordination of themes of RTI relevance among the different levelsof competence. At the same time, the framework conditions for the implementation of the RTI strategy havechanged – especially due to the sustained phase of economic weakness as a consequence of the financialand economic crisis of 2008. Due to this “structural disruption”, the ambitious goals defined in the RTI stra-tegies soon faced budgetary constraints, which in turn caused a shift in priorities and changes to the portfo-lio of the measures – a situation that has lasted to this very day. 34

As regards the objective of increasing R&D intensity to 3.76%, progress has been achieved as revealed by thefact that the 3% mark was surpassed for the first time in 2014. Overall, however, the attainment of the objec-tives has become increasingly unlikely due to the flattening of the dynamic growth of the years 1995 to 2007,a trend that started with the economic and financial crisis in 2008.

Spending by the public sector has surpassed the “targeted trajectory”. Accordingly, the greatest challenge tothe attainment of the target lies mainly in the endeavour to raise R&D intensity in the private sector. Manymeasures of the RTI strategy of the federal government are therefore designed as incentives and support forthe private sector in order to attain this higher level of R&D in the business sector. If this fails, or is not achieved to a sufficient degree, it seems very unlikely that the targeted ratio will be achieved.35

Multi-level governance

Austria is a federal state and the regions – in this case,the Länder – have autonomous, elected political repre-sentatives and budgets. The RTI strategy of the federalgovernment serves as guidance in this context. Learn -ing from each other and together is of key importancefor the system. The location profiles are differentiatedby the regional priorities defined by the Länder.

Austrian started pursuing a territorial policy ap-proach very early and this can be seen in the develop-ment schemes from the 1980s based on endogenousrenewal. After it joined the EU in 1995, innovationwas increasingly integrated into these schemes andfrom the mid-2000s onwards, the schemes started fo-cusing more and more on research and innovation.

Encouraged not least by the EU programming cyclesand the related programmatic work as well as in con-nection with the growing strategic orientation of theinterventions, the Länder started developing deve-lopment strategies in the 1990s. Starting in 2000, the

strategies started to shift from general economic stra-tegies towards research and innovation strategies.Today, all Länder have concepts for economic and in-novation or research policy schemes. These take intoaccount the overarching EU and national policies andthe specific strengths of the regions. The specificforms, design, planning timeframe and content takeguidance from the regional situation.

As the Länder schemes are cyclically reviewed with atime delay, the Länder have the possibility of ex -changing views among each other and with the fede-ral government, thus supporting a learning processamong the Länder. The review intervals are graduallystarting to coincide more and more with the periodsdefined by the EU financial framework.

Fundamental orientation of the Länderstrategies

Apart from the thematic priorities defined, the stra-tegies of the Länder follow the fundamental orienta-tion set out below:g Joint financing of programmes, such as the CO-

MET programme (see priority definitions). Thebottom-up networking of science and businesssupports the orientation on special (regional)strengths and the centres reflect the specificregion al specialisations in science and business.

g The structures that emerge from the federal pro-grammes (which aim for excellence as a goal in itselfand do not pursue any regional policy aspects) aresupplemented in order to improve their region al in-tegration into existing location systems (e.g. colla-boration with universities to create professorshipsbased on grants for specific priority themes).

g The innovation basis of companies is broadenedin a thematically open manner to integrate morecompanies into research and development, andinto systematic innovation processes.

g The cluster concept plays an important role espe-cially at the regional level and has proven a robusteconomic policy instrument since the 1990s. Thesignificance of clusters has changed over time,from industry-dominated associations built alongvalue chains towards networks with specific profi-les, joint R&D and innovation. Therefore, clustersare a key instrument for the development of strate-gies the regional Smart Specialisation.47

Strategic definition of priorities and themes

The locational profile in Austria is ultimately differen-tiated by the locational strategies and profiles deve -loped at the Länder level. Financial assistance for ocation and project development is distributed bythematic area for which priorities have been definedwithin the regional innovation system or for whichdeficits have been recognized.

Use of ERDF funds within the strategies

The funds of the European Regional DevelopmentFund (ERDF) (annually around EUR 28 million) areused for Objective 1 theme “Strengthening Re-search, Technological Development and Innovati-on” – aligned with the RTI strategies – to strengthenthe location-specific R&I capacities along the re-gional strengths and thematic fields. New researchstructures have been built up in the past at thejunction of science and economy as competencecentres by national measures and in some caseswith the support of EU funding. However, the pro-cess of systematically deepening the territorial sy-stems of infrastructure and services through the ex-pansion of specific research competencies has notyet been completed. Existing structures are to becomplemented by specific research infrastructureand competencies in order to attain a critical massand rise to the standard of the national and interna-

tional programmes. Together with research institu-tions, a local “innovation eco-system” of high-in-tensity R&D companies, start-ups, and research andeducational institutions that interact closely witheach another is to be created. In regions with lessresearch activity, attention focuses on easily acces-sible measures and transfer mechanisms (e.g. Bur-genland, Salzburg), while in R&D-intensive regionswith a strong institutional setting, the aim is toachieve regional integration, a broader base and theestablishment of internationally prominent infra-structures. Additionally, in line with the FTI strate-gies of the federal government and of the Länder,the aim is broaden the innovation basis and ex-

Strategies of the Länder and their priorities:an overview

The following section presents the regional strategypriorities of the Länder defined within this frame-work. The breakdown of this Länder presentation fol-lows the structural economic priorities of the regions:

Service-oriented metropolitan region

Vienna as a metropolitan region is the location of theheadquarters of multiregional Austrian companieswith the respective dispositive functions and featuresa high concentration of research and developmentactivities. Based on the first RTI strategy “Vienna -Thinking the Future” (Wien denkt Zukunft) (2008)and the framework strategy “Smart City Vienna”(Smart City Wien) adopted in 2014, the strategy “In-novatives Wien 2020” (Innovative Vienna 2020) wasprepared in a broad, inclusive process and adopted in2015. The framework strategy “Smart City Vienna” de-fined the two goals of positioning Vienna as one of thetop five research centres of Europe by 2050 and takingadvantage of the innovation triangle Vienna-Brno-Bratislava as one of the most promising regions inEurope. The purpose is to target and further developthe RTI strong points: life sciences, ICT, creative indu-stries, humanities, cultural and social sciences, andcertain areas of mathematics/physics. The objectivesdefined in the RTI strategy follow a generally systemicapproach. From the standpoint of a metropolitanarea, the objectives refer primarily to future challen-ges that affect the city or region as a whole and requi-re comprehensive systemic solutions, a circumstancealso reflected in the objectives: Vienna as a city of op-portunities with an innovative city administration,and Vienna as a place of encounters. Innovation hasbeen intentionally conceptualised broadly, and as re-gards open innovation, the participation of the de-mand side in innovation processes plays a key role.

The implementation of the RTI strategy is defined inthe annual working programmes.

Regions with a strong industrial base

Carinthia is working on the creation of a regional,thematically-specialised innovation system. With theexpansion of the institutional innovation system,especially the research activities of leading compa-nies, the regional R&D ratio was lifted from below 1%to 2.83%. In this context, a strategy is being pursuedof embedding the Carinthian system of innovationinto the Alpe Adria region (cooperation projects). TheRTI strategy “Kärnten 2020 - Zukunft durch Innovati-on” adoped already in 2009 and complemented bythe economic strategy for Carinthia 2013 to 2020, ad-dresses the three areas of the knowledge triangle:education (strengthen Carinthian universities), re-search (intensify cooperation between science andbusiness) and innovation (broaden the innovationbase in Carinthian). Research and innovation capaci-ties are to be strengthened with the help of endowedprofessorships and specialised research clustersalong the priority themes, especially in the area ofhigher education. Apart from the thematically-openmobilisation of R&D and the promotion of the inno-vation capacities of all companies with potential, afocus is placed on information and communicationtechnologies (self-controlled, networked systems),sustainability technologies and materials (renewableresources and ICT synergy priorities like smart ener-gy, control technologies, energy efficiency) and pro-duction technologies at the interfaces of IT, controltechnology and module switching technology (Indu-stry 4.0). To develop the corresponding locations withinternational appeal in the central areas, the infra-structures needed for a new generation of scienceand technology parks are set up.

Lower Austria began the reorientation of its regionalinnovation policy when it started participating in theEU RIS Initiative and has stayed on this course of in-ternational exchange activities over the past one-and-a-half decades. The implementation of thestrands “Innovation & Technology” are defined in Lower Austria’s innovation pyramid. The technologyand innovation partnership serves as basis and isaim ed at mobilizing existing innovation potential tosupport (all) companies with potential, strengthentheir competitiveness through innovation, and achieve modernisation and structural change, for ex-ample, through new key technologies. Clusters arecreated to initiate – thematically-focused – leadingcooperative and international R&D projects in thefields of the future. With the creation of technopoles,location development follows clearly-defined tech-nology fields at the confluence of science, economyand higher education. The aims are to achieve critical

mass, international visibility and location develop-ment. In accordance with this concept, thematic are-as of specialisation are created within the clusters.Currently defined areas: environmentally-benignconstruction, food, plastics and mechatronics. Thepriorities at the technopoles for research which con-centrate on excellence and critical mass are on medi-cal biotechnology (Krems), agricultural and environ-mental technology (Tulln), bio-energy, agricultureand food technology (Wieselburg), and medical andmaterials technologies (Wiener Neustadt).

Upper Austria as an industrially-dominated Land hasworked intensely in the past 25 years on a location poli-cy to build up a specialised regional innovation system,and in this context, it has promoted mainly researchand educational capacities. The strategic economic andresearch programme “Innovatives OÖ 2020” (“Innovati-ve Upper Austria 2020”) consistently follows the inno-vation chain education-research-business, and pursu-es a productivity-oriented growth strategy. The fourcore strategies defined (location development, indu-strial market leadership, internationalisation, futuretechnologies) were defined in an intensive discussionprocess that followed a top-down and bottom-up logic.Five fields of action were arrived at for the Land: (i) in-dustrial production processes, (ii) energy, (iii) healthand aging society, (iv) food and nutrition, and (v) mobi-lity and logistics. For every action field, strategic priorityobjectives and goals were defined for education-re-search-business. Upper Austria, as a Demonstrator Re-gion for Service Innovation (within the ESIC Initiative)has focused on innovation in services to accelerate theindustrial renewal process and to achieve a higher levelof competitiveness over the long term. The develop-ment strategy was monitored by the Council for Re-search and Technology for Upper Austria (Rat für For-schung und Technologie für Oberösterreich, RFT OÖ)and was adopted by the federal government and theLand parliament.

Styria is an industrially-dominated region with a re-search ratio of 4.8%, making it one of the most re-search-intensive regions of Austria. The innovationstrategy in the meaning of intelligent specialisation isrepresented by the scheme “Economic and TourismStrategy Styria 2025 – Growth through Innovation"(Wirtschafts- und Tourismusstrategie Steiermark 2025– Wachstum durch Innovation). It is oriented on ap-plied research and promotes the areas of confluenceof science and business, especially through COMETCentres. The strategy of the Land Styria to promotescience and research complements this objective andconcentrates on the science system and thus also co-vers the relevant elements of basic research. Styriatherefore pursues the ambitious goal of becoming areal benchmark for change for a knowledge-basedproduction society in the EU. In this context, the aim

is to support innovation dynamic of the leading com-panies, integrate more companies into the innovati-on processes, and enlarge the focus to include ser-vices. The key market-driven themes are (i) mobility,(ii) green-tech, (iii) health-tech. These are supportedby the core technology competencies: materials tech-nology, production technology, machinery and plantengineering, digital technology and microelectronics.The creative industries are positioned as “innovationsupporters”. In the collaboration of the actors in theclusters along the knowledge triangle, detailed strate-gies were defined for the key themes in an “entrepre-neurial discovery process”.

Vorarlberg is one of the most strongly growing regi-ons in Europe. The economy in Vorarlberg has anabove average high rate of exports. Vorarlberg'sstrengths lie in its focus on applied research, which isconducted mostly at companies and is therefore gui-ded directly by the needs and requirements of themarket. This is also reflected in the fact that it has highest share of company-financed R&D spending inall of Austria. Vorarlberg has successfully masteredstructural change in the past by overcoming the extre-me domination of the textiles and garments industry,and transitioning towards metallurgy and the pro-duction of food and beverages. The strategic basis forits innovation and location policy is constituted bythe economic guiding principles defined by the go-vernment of Vorarlberg (Vorarlberg WirtschaftsleitbildVorarlberg) (2014) and the science and research stra-tegy for Vorarlberg 2020+ (Wissenschafts- und For-schungsstrategie Vorarlberg 2020+). In line with thecore competencies of Vorarlberg’s economy, the ex-pansion of the financial assistance schemes for sci-ence and research concentrate in the following areas:smart textiles, energy and energy efficiency, humansand technology, education and health, intelligentproduction. The corresponding action fields of thetwo strategies are focused on the improvement of theinnovation capacity of companies (advisory and sup-port, innovation management), facilitation of accessto financing instruments, promotion of entrepreneu-rial potential, promotion of cooperation and net-works especially in the areas of education and qualifi-cation, especially with respect to energy and resourceefficiency. A special focus is placed on the cross-bor-der transfer of technology and knowledge (e.g. withinthe framework of the university association of the “In-ternational University of Lake Constance”).

Mixed economic structures: High focus onservices with selective strengths in industrial production and research

Salzburg’s principal concern is to further strengthenand expand the partly very heterogeneous and small-scale science and research structures in a targeted

and concentrated manner. Essential for “intelligentspecialisation" is to make use of existing synergiesand to avoid redundancies, to concentrate on attai-ning “critical mass” at the location based on the prin-ciple of “strengthening the strong points”, and to takeguidance from the requirements of Salzburg’s econo-my and society when expanding the structural basis.The following five guiding principles of the Scienceand Innovation Strategy for Salzburg 2025 (WISS2025), which was adopted in February 2016 by theLand parliament, pay due attention to this: 1. science,research and innovation are key competitive factorsfor Salzburg; 2. specialisation and cooperation areprerequisites for the further development of the re-gional innovation system; 3. success in science, re-search and innovation requires consistentinternation alisation; 4. education, further educationand career opportunities based on high standards; 5.governance for the strategic steering, implementati-on and evaluation opens new paths. The analysis andconceptual work done in an intense dialogue bet-ween science and business yielded five thematicfields with high potential for intelligent specialisationin Salzburg and the creation of critical mass there: (i)life sciences, (ii) ICT location Salzburg, (iii) smart ma-terials, (iv) intelligent construction and settlement sy-stems, (v) creative industries and innovation in ser-vices. This corresponds to Salzburg’s economicprogramme 2020: “Salzburg. Business Location - Fu-ture” (Salzburg. Standort Zukunft) (2011) whose ob-jectives and measures specifically addresses the areas(i) “location development” along the knowledge tri-angle “economy-education-science” including a the-matic profile, (ii) “corporate development” with a fo-cus on entrepreneurial R&D and (iii) “governance”,among others, also with strategies to expand the sy-stem of regional innovation. For Salzburg, the aim isthe specialisation of university and non-university re-search by bringing it closer to the needs of the busi-ness sector in the thematic priorities and the expansi-on of corporate innovation activity by systematicallyencouraging companies to engage in R&D.

Tyrol is characterised by a strong science sector (threeuniversities, three specialised colleges and several re-search institutions). Entrepreneurial R&D is concen-trated at a small number of larger companies with in-tensive research activity. The Alpine location and therelated locational requirements (including climatechange) and tourism shape the framework for pro-blem-based research and innovation. The researchand innovation strategy (2013) adopted by the Tyrole-an Land government defines general guiding princi-ples for the advancement of innovation and researchat the location that is sustainable, forward-lookingand competitive and supports the location’s prioritiesand strengths. Specific details of the R&D strategy aredefined in a working programme. The following the-

mes have been defined as the thematic priorities: lifesciences, materials and production (mechatronics,materials, especially timber), information technolo-gies and also environment and energy (renewableenergy source, Alpine region), wellness/tourism aswell as the creative industries for the services sector.

Transitional region according to the definitionof the Structural Funds: without own regionalagglomerations

For geographic and historic reasons, and because it isa predominantly rural region without any agglomera-tions, Burgenland – as a former Objective 1 and nowtransitional region – scarcely has any research-inten-sive economic branches or industrial enterprises. Un-til 20 years ago, there were no research-linked, tertia-ry educational institutions or non-university researchinstitutions. Since Austria’s accession to the EU, Bur-genland has completed an impressive catching-upprocess with respect to infrastructure, economy andeducation. Its closeness to the central place of Viennaand the ties of its southern part to the region of Grazare the contact points that create access to researchcompetence. With a view to the strengths of the inno-vation-driven development, the following strategyfields were defined: (i) raise awareness for RTI, (ii) in-crease human resources, (iii) enlarge research infra-structure and (iv) services for pre-start-ups, start-ups,companies, industry, (v) set up RTI coordination. At-tention is placed on Burgenland’s core thematicfields: (i) sustainable energy (themes such as renewa-ble energy, new construction materials, energy effi-ciency in buildings), (ii) sustainable quality of life re-lating to segments of life sciences (health andwellness, medical technology, food and beverages,hospitality services) and (iii) intelligent processes,technologies and products. RTI fields with a specialpotential for collaboration are (optical-) electronics,mechatronics, materials (plastics, wood, metal) andtheir intelligent application. Further inclusive fieldsof action with special significance for Burgenland arefuture production technologies (Industry 4.0), inno-vative (IT-supported) services and the creative indu-stries. Implementation follows the principle of rollingstrategy development. The strategic developmentand detailed operational planning of measures is car-ried out every year.

Austria’s innovation system and innovation policy ha-ve undergone a clear transformation. Today, Austria isa business location with a mature RTI system withglobally networked institutions and a good system ofcooperation between science and business, and ahigh degree of internationalisation and competitive-ness on international markets (niche awareness).

Austria is characterized by a highly developed cultureof always working to balance conflicting interests andof involving stakeholders in planning processes; bymany years of broad consensus between politics, thebusiness sector and society as well as between national and regional actors regarding investments inscience, research, technology and innovation. Busi-ness enterprises and their interest group representa-tives are traditionally strongly involved in RTI policiesin the spirit of “entrepreneurial discovery”.

Austria has a balanced mix of instruments for fun-ding RTI projects which are used in the attempt toidentify the fundamental moments of market and sy-stem failure. Generally in Austria, financial assistanceschemes are strongly oriented on generic, technolo-gically-open funding instruments. This also takes intoaccount the diversified industrial and economicstructure with companies focused on market niches.And finally, these investments in research/education,sustainability, social inclusion and in diversified eco-nomic and location structures enable a high resili-ence to crises.

With respect to policy definition, Austria has nowshifted towards “smart specialisation mode”.

In 2011, the RTI strategy “Becoming an InnovationLeader” was adopted. The strategy created the con-sensus for a new vision of development (from “cat-ching-up” to "frontrunning”). Although the conceptof Smart Specialisation was not yet public at the time,the federal government produced the RTI strategywhich already anticipated key elements of the SmartSpecialisation strategy such as the broadly-basedcreation and implementation process and the moni-toring of implementation.

Austria …g follows a systemic approach in the FTI strategy for

the measures and the attainment of objectives;

g operationalises the fundamental RTI policy priori-ties defined and addresses the grand challenges.The concrete design of the instruments and pro-grammes is done by the competent ministries andagencies; in this context, the thematic prioritiesare addressed;

g focuses strongly on strengthening private RTI in-vestment activity (frontrunner companies, broad-ening the innovation base, knowledge-intensivestart-ups);

g defines a management process by setting up a taskforce at the highest level of public officials includ -ing theme-specific working groups as well as by as-signing the task of monitoring to the Council forResearch and Technology Development;

g has a highly developed monitoring and evaluationculture of public financial assistance schemes andinvestments.

In the spirit of the policy framework, Austria relies onthe principle of multi-level governance and has long-years of experience with a closely-knit system of auto-nomous but nonetheless coordinated multi-yearstrategic planning at all levels (national/regional/in-stitutional).

The concrete development of the location profile forAustria is done at Länder level where the strengthsand promising areas for a knowledge-based economyand its integration into the international value chainbased on endogenous location factors are defined.This means that the diversified economic and loca -tion structure and the strong orientation of compa-nies on niches are taken into account.

Today, all Länder have the relevant RTI strategies,budgets for financial assistance schemes and agen-cies that support the implementation of the strate-gies. Regular monitoring and reporting mechanismsare in place. Moreover, the federal government andLänder meet regularly to engage in dialogue.

The strategy and the interaction of the federal govern-ment and Länder do not follow a major master plan.Master plans tend to be of importance during “cat-ching-up phases” and less in mature and institutional-ly-differentiated RTI systems. As regards the interactionof the federal government and Länder, this is a comple-mentary system characterized by mutual learning. The
